Abstract

The invention discloses a kind of dynamic human face recognition methods, if described method include extracting face characteristic data with set up key population data base, carry out monitor video whether the moving object of moving body track, detecting and tracking exists face and be ranked up, extract face characteristic data according to optimum facial image, the face characteristic data of acquisition and the face characteristic data in key population data base being compared finds have the face of high similarity with personnel in storehouse, sends the steps such as information.The invention also discloses a kind of dynamic human face recognition system, described system includes DBM, motion tracking module, image collection module, characteristic extracting module, feature comparing module and reminding module, further, including optimum face judge module and camera driver module.The dynamic human face recognition methods of present invention offer and system, the face characteristic that can extract in monitor video is compared, and is sent information when the result that discovery similarity is higher.

A kind of dynamic human face recognition methods embodiment one
As it is shown in figure 1, a kind of dynamic human face recognition methods, described dynamic human face recognition methods bag Include following steps:
Step S1: extract face characteristic data to set up key population data base;
Described step S1 extracts face characteristic data to set up being embodied as of key population data base Mode can be: by obtaining related personnel's identity information with national public security system, household register system, And personal information in key population data base, obtain all personnel by existing photograph image etc. Face characteristic data, set up demographic data storehouse, set up for personnel in key population data base Key population data base.
In actual applications, in described key population data base, personnel can be high-risk group, such as The fugitive personnel in the whole nation, terrorist and previous conviction personnel etc., can be set to black by these high-risk group List.
In actual applications, in described key population data base, personnel can be the crowd that passes through especially, The management personnel in such as certain building, the current personnel of indult, People's Armed Police, public security etc., can This kind of crowd is set to white list.
Step S2: real-time dynamic monitoring video is carried out moving body track;
Described step S2 carries out the specific embodiment party of moving body track to real-time dynamic monitoring video Formula can be: by observing real-time dynamic monitoring video, the moving object to occurring in video is carried out Follow the tracks of.
In actual applications, described real-time dynamic monitoring video is by DSP video camera or network IP high-definition camera is monitored production, can take the photograph at described DSP video camera or network IP high definition Camera performs step S4.
Step S3: whether there is face in the moving object of detecting and tracking and be ranked up;
Whether the moving object of described step S3 detecting and tracking exists face the tool being ranked up Body embodiment can be: whether there is face in the moving object of detecting and tracking, and according to face Movement locus and contour feature, by great amount of samples training obtain human-face detector, according to Face eyes opening and closing situation, direction of visual lines and facial orientation carry out optimum facial image sequence.
In actual applications, optimum face can be with China second-generation identity card certificate photo as standard, just Face is amimia, uniform light, without fuzzy, and the facial image of the eyeball that keeps one's eyes open.
In actual applications, the identification of optimum face can include following manner:
Facial feature localization----judge expression;
Attitude Algorithm----judge facial orientation;
Illumination algorithm----judge that luminosity is the most uniform, it is high light or backlight;
Fuzziness judges---whether image obscures.In actual applications, in the motion of detecting and tracking When whether object exists face, move by following the tracks of target object, detect whether it is personnel, Then proceed to detect the face whether these personnel occur in video, the most just face is tracked Judge optimum face.
In actual applications, in the moving object of detecting and tracking, whether there is face and arrange During sequence, can automatically lock picture occur everyone, the most anti-for the people hovered in picture Multiple identification, at utmost reduces interference.
Step S4: extract face characteristic data inputting face characteristic number according to optimum facial image According to storehouse;
Described step S4 extracts face characteristic data inputting face characteristic according to optimum facial image Data base specifically can comprise the following steps that
Follow the tracks of optimum facial image;
Use Inline Function and fixed-point calculation that the facial image intercepted is carried out positioning feature point and spy Value indicative is extracted;
The face characteristic value typing facial feature database that will extract.
In actual applications, according to optimum facial image and extract face characteristic data and comprise the steps that
Reducing broad image, attitude is corrected;
Carry out eigenvalue location, position including face, facial feature localization etc.;
Behind location, picture is normalized;
Calculate eigenvalue according to the picture after processing, specifically can pass through geometry location, use small echo The modes such as conversion calculate eigenvalue.
In actual applications, eigenvalue comprises the steps that geometrical relationship;Color;Specific characteristic, than Such as the nevus of face, birthmark etc..
In actual applications, the detailed description of the invention following the tracks of optimum facial image can be: to optimum Facial image carries out Image semantic classification;Pretreated image is carried out Face datection;To detection The face gone out carries out algorithm keeps track.
In actual applications, described employing Inline Function and the fixed-point calculation facial image to intercepting Carrying out positioning feature point and characteristics extraction is high at DSP video camera or network IP when being embodied as Clear video camera performs, in wherein Inline Function is the hardware that described video camera chips is corresponding Connection function.
In actual applications, the described face characteristic value typing facial feature database that will extract Before execution, described video camera needs the face characteristic value extracted and other face information data It is transferred to server with typing facial feature database.
In actual applications, described employing Inline Function and the fixed-point calculation facial image to intercepting The process that implements carrying out positioning feature point and characteristics extraction can be as follows:
A kind of facial modeling combined based on geometric projection and template matching is used to calculate Method;First sciagraphy coarse positioning eye position is used;Then in this result, use PCA template Matching method is accurately positioned;Finally according to the position location of eyes, use the 2 of sciagraphy location nose Individual angle point and nose.
The key step of feature extraction is as follows:
Measurement Relation extraction eyebrow according to face and eyes window;
To eyebrow and eyes window inner projection coarse positioning eye position;The eyebrow and the eyes window that obtain are Rectangle frame, if rectangle frame left upper apex coordinate and the coordinate of bottom right vertex, closes according to projection function System, in calculation block any point in the horizontal direction with the average gray value in vertical direction, eyebrow Hair and eyeball are black compared with other location comparisons, and gray value is in the horizontal direction at eyebrow and eyeball 2 gray scale valley points occur, eyeball is again in the lower section of eyebrow simultaneously, thus utilizes the level of gray scale Coordinate determines eye center coordinate in vertical direction;According to the eyebrow obtained and eye center Coordinate again extract the window comprising only eyes, owing to pupil is more black and the horizontal edge of eye socket Obvious, in eyes window, the upright projection of gray scale and the upright projection of horizontal edge determine eyes The horizontal coordinate at center;
Eye normalization is calibrated;
PCA template matching is accurately positioned eyes;
Measurement Relation extraction nose window according to face;
Window inner projection determines nose position;
Face information is expressed by utilizing discrete cosine transform and PCA template matching method to extract The local feature that ability is strong, this local feature includes eyes, nose and face, utilizes people simultaneously Face identification Fisherface method and simple spectrum holes method extract the global feature of face, merge Local feature and global feature.
The step stating face by characteristic vector is as follows:
Positioning feature point algorithm is utilized to obtain the positional information of human face, according to the structure of face Feature splits each organic region;Wherein, during eye areas is centrally located at two lines of centres At Dian, size be 1.6de × 0.5de, de be two distances between centers after naturalization;Nasal area Height sized by be 0.6de × 0.5de;
If I (x, y), Ic (x, y) and In (x, y) be respectively facial image, eye areas image and Nasal area image, extracts each image information with DCT respectively:
Xh=Reshape (F (I), nh)
Xe=Reshape (F (Ie), ne)
Xn=Reshape (F (In), nn)
Wherein, Xh, Xe and Xn are respectively the DCT of facial image, eye areas and nasal area Feature, (A, function n) is the upper left n × n submatrix of extraction two-dimensional matrix A to function Reshape And this submatrix is converted to a n2 dimensional vector;Use series connection method, by vector Xh, Xe Fusion feature vector Y0:Y0=(XhT, XeT, XnT) T is formed with Xn series connection;
Face assemblage characteristic vector Y:Y=(Y0-μ)/σ is obtained after removing mean normalization;
In formula, the mean vector of μ=E (Y0) training sample fusion feature;E () is mathematic expectaion letter Number, σ is corresponding variance vectors.
Step S5: face characteristic data and the face characteristic in key population data base that will obtain Data are compared;
Described step S5 is by special with the face in key population data base for the face characteristic data obtained Levying the detailed description of the invention that data compare can be: will obtain the eigenvalue of optimum facial image Generate after in key population data base, key population standard certificate photo eigenvalue is identified comparison Similarity, similarity exceedes pre-set threshold value, then extract all personnel higher than predetermined threshold value Image, and according to similarity height sequence, and certain concrete personnel corresponding.
In actual applications, time in described comparison process, specifically by described optimum facial image Eigenvalue compare with the face characteristic in described blacklist.
In actual applications, time in described comparison process, specifically by described optimum facial image Eigenvalue compare with the face characteristic in described white list.
Step S6: if discovery has the personnel of high similarity with personnel in key population data base, Send information.
After described step S5 has performed, sort and key population can be obtained by similarity height The comparing result that in data base, in personnel, concrete personnel are similar, then sends out according to this comparing result Go out information.
In actual applications, judge according to comparing result, if finding and key population data In storehouse, in personnel, blacklist has the personnel of high similarity, then indicate in monitored picture, Show photo and the associated personal information of these personnel, send the information of specific rank.
In actual applications, judge according to comparing result, if finding and key population data In storehouse, in personnel, blacklist has the personnel of high similarity, then indicate in video pictures, Show photo and the associated personal information of this blacklist personnel, in conjunction with current monitoring place, Send the alarm of different stage, point out on duty, patrol Security Personnel's further detailed tracking ratio Right.
In actual applications, judge according to comparing result, if finding and key population data In storehouse, in personnel, white list has the personnel of high similarity, then indicate in monitored picture, Show photo and the associated personal information of these personnel, and send information and notify management personnel Further confirm that.
Dynamic human face recognition methods described in the present embodiment can be in situation about coordinating without personnel Under, automatically extract the optimum face in monitor video, warehouse-in preserve and with backstage key population number Carry out real-time comparison according to storehouse, find the timely early warning of comparison result that similarity is higher, meet public affairs The application demand of security protection video monitoring field management and control efficient to all kinds of personnel altogether.

Step S7: in monitor video, face is tracked according to eigenvalue;
Described step S7 is according to being embodied as that face is tracked in monitor video by eigenvalue Mode can be: the face features value trace face extracted according to step S4, was following the tracks of Needing in journey to be continually changing eigenvalue according to face characteristic, such as front just transfers lateral feature value to Can be along with change.Such that it is able to obtain people be tracked meeting some eigenvalue.
In actual applications, built by public safety face identification system, it is achieved personnel tracking And alarm mode is gathered information (face character) by artificial collection of information afterwards to dynamic realtime Transformation, fully grasp hotel, Internet bar, bayonet socket, etc. omnibearing multidate information, public Peace relevant departments build recognition of face comparison cloud computing platform, carry out " the most pre-to emphasis personnel Evidence obtaining, follow-up tracking in police, thing " whole process supervision, it is achieved " allow each photographic head become 24 hours round-the-clock electronic polices ", embody public security science and technology and warn by force, improve existing society video Science and high efficiency, make public security in time, accurately, dynamically grasp local safety situation, Realize the new effect in advance prevented.
